JCVD against Dolph. Lundgren, Michel Qissi, or even Bolo Yeung, his legendary adversaries from Universal Soldier, Kickboxer, and Double Impact? What’s My Name promises? the last action film of the Belgian star’s career.

At 61, Jean-Claude Van Damme believes it is time for him to retire and make way for young people. Interviewed by Deadline, the actor announces the filming this year of What’s My Name? in Paris, a film that looks like a tribute to his career.

With the realization of Jeremy Zag (a Frenchman among others the producer of Miraculous) and with the scenario Nick Vallelonga (Green Book) and Paul Sloan (the Black Antenna series inspired by the group Alice In Chains).
The story: Following an accident, JCVD who plays his own role has amnesia. Without any memory of his past life, he will find himself facing the most emblematic adversaries of his film career.

“I wanted to leave the scene by revisiting my career” he confides to Deadline, ” starting with Bloodsport, the movie that made me famous. I want this movie to be a new Bloodsport but on a higher level….

In this new movie, we will integrate elements of my real life… I came from Belgium to Hollywood. I succeeded, I failed, I came back. In the film, I come out of a preview of yet another action film.
I am unhappy because I’ve been living in hotel rooms for 30 years which is true. And boom, a car knocks me over because I’m drunk. When I wake up I can’t remember my name and nobody knows who I am.”

What’s my name? is described as a big mainstream action movie in which JCVD is a real human superhero. After this film, Van Damme intends to enjoy life, his family, and his boat, he explains.
